CVE-2017-5818: Input Validation

Published Feb 15, 2018
·
Updated

A Remote Code Execution vulnerability in HPE Intelligent Management Center (iMC) PLAT version 7.3 E0504P04 was found.

Frequently Asked Questions

1

What is the severity of CVE-2017-5818?

CVE-2017-5818 has a high severity rating, indicating a significant risk of remote code execution.

2

How do I fix CVE-2017-5818?

To fix CVE-2017-5818, you should upgrade HPE Intelligent Management Center to the latest patched version that addresses this vulnerability.

3

What are the affected versions of HPE Intelligent Management Center for CVE-2017-5818?

The affected versions for CVE-2017-5818 include HPE Intelligent Management Center versions up to 7.3 and specifically versions 7.3-e0503p02 and 7.3-e0504p02.

4

What type of vulnerability is CVE-2017-5818?

CVE-2017-5818 is classified as a Remote Code Execution vulnerability.

5

Can CVE-2017-5818 be exploited without authentication?

Yes, CVE-2017-5818 can potentially be exploited remotely without user authentication, allowing attackers to execute arbitrary code.
